Bear Safety in Branson: A Guide for Visitors
Bear Sightings: What to Do and What Not to Do
While it’s unlikely you’ll encounter a black bear during your visit to Branson, it’s always wise to be prepared. If you do spot a bear, remain calm and avoid making any sudden movements. Slowly and quietly back away from the animal, keeping your distance. Never approach, follow, or feed a bear.
Avoid Direct Eye Contact or Running
Bears may perceive direct eye contact or running as a threat, so avoid these behaviors at all costs. Instead, opt for a non-threatening stance, avoiding any gestures or vocalizations that could be interpreted as aggression.
Secure Food and Scented Items
Bears are attracted to food and scented items, so it’s crucial to secure these properly. Never leave food or trash unattended, and store scented items like toiletries and cosmetics in airtight containers. This reduces the risk of attracting bears and minimizes the chances of an encounter.
Follow These Additional Safety Tips
- Be Aware of Your Surroundings: Pay attention to your environment and keep an eye out for signs of bears, such as footprints, scat, or hair.
- Stay on Designated Trails: Stay on marked trails while hiking to avoid surprising a bear.
- Supervise Children: Keep children close and within your sight at all times, especially when near dense vegetation.
- Carry Bear Spray as a Precaution: While unlikely, carrying bear spray can provide peace of mind. Be sure to store it properly and follow the manufacturer’s instructions for use.

Lake Taneycomo: A Haven for Anglers, with Minimal Bear Concerns
Amidst the vibrant wilderness of Branson, Missouri, anglers and nature enthusiasts alike flock to Lake Taneycomo, renowned for its exceptional trout fishing. This picturesque lake, nestled within the Ozark Mountains, offers a tranquil retreat with minimal bear sightings, providing visitors with a sense of ease while they cast their lines.
While exploring the shimmering waters of Lake Taneycomo, it’s advisable to remain alert to your surroundings. Keep an eye out for any signs of wildlife, particularly during morning and evening hours when bears are most active. If you encounter any bears, remain calm and slowly back away without making direct eye contact. Avoid running, as this could trigger a chase response.
Securely storing food and scented items is crucial to prevent attracting bears. Keep your food in airtight containers and dispose of garbage properly. By following these precautions, you can minimize the likelihood of encountering bears and enjoy your fishing or boating experience with peace of mind.
